It seems the rule compiler is not correctly checking type safety when using window operators to define rule conditions.

I defined a rule using the following code (note that I incorrectly used "time:window" to define the window, instead of "window:time"):

declare SensorReading
    @role(event)
    @timestamp(timestamp)
end

rule "boilers"
    when
        $b1: (SensorReading(sensorId == 1L && status == SensorStatus.ON) over time:window(10s)) 
    then
         ....
end

The rule has been compiled and executed, but not following the correct window semantics.  The forum link contains a full description of the (unexpected) behaviour I found when defining rule like this.
